1.1. Optimize Windows Power Settings
Ensure your CPU and GPU are receiving consistent power, preventing throttling and maximizing performance during intense gameplay.
-
Set Power Plan to 'High Performance' High impact
Go to Control Panel > Hardware and Sound > Power Options. Select 'High Performance' or 'Ultimate Performance' if available. This ensures your CPU runs at maximum frequency.
-
Disable Link State Power Management Medium impact
In advanced power settings, navigate to 'PCI Express' > 'Link State Power Management' and set it to 'Off' for both On battery and Plugged in. This prevents power saving on your PCIe bus.
-
Disable USB Selective Suspend Low impact
Under 'USB settings' in advanced power options, disable 'USB selective suspend setting'. This can prevent peripherals like your mouse or keyboard from briefly losing power.
2.2. Disable Unnecessary Background Applications
Free up valuable CPU, RAM, and network resources by preventing non-essential applications from running in the background.
-
Manage Startup Applications High impact
Open Task Manager (Ctrl+Shift+Esc), go to the 'Startup' tab, and disable any programs you don't need running immediately after Windows boots.
-
Turn Off Background Apps (Windows Settings) High impact
Go to Windows Settings > Privacy > Background apps. Toggle off 'Let apps run in the background' or individually disable apps you don't use while gaming.
-
Close Unused Programs via Task Manager Medium impact
Before launching Valorant, open Task Manager and end tasks for any open applications (browsers, launchers, etc.) that are not critical for your game.
3.3. Configure Windows Graphics Settings & Game Mode
Utilize Windows' built-in gaming optimizations to prioritize Valorant and enhance GPU performance for your GTX 1660.
-
Enable Hardware-accelerated GPU Scheduling High impact
Go to Settings > System > Display > Graphics settings. Toggle 'Hardware-accelerated GPU scheduling' to On. Requires a restart. This can reduce input lag and improve performance.
-
Enable Game Mode Medium impact
Go to Settings > Gaming > Game Mode and ensure it is 'On'. Windows will optimize your PC for gaming when it detects a game running.
-
Set Graphics Performance Preference for Valorant High impact
In Graphics settings, browse for 'VALORANT.exe' (usually in Riot Games\Valorant\live\ShooterGame\Binaries\Win64) and set its preference to 'High performance'.

4.4. Update Drivers and Operating System
Keeping your system's drivers and Windows up-to-date ensures compatibility, stability, and access to the latest performance optimizations.
-
Update NVIDIA Graphics Drivers High impact
Download the latest GeForce Game Ready Driver directly from NVIDIA's website. Perform a 'Custom' installation and check 'Perform a clean installation'.
-
Run Windows Update Medium impact
Go to Settings > Update & Security > Windows Update and check for any pending updates. Install all critical and optional updates.
-
Update Chipset Drivers Low impact
Visit your motherboard manufacturer's website and download the latest chipset drivers for your specific model. Outdated chipset drivers can cause system instability.
5.5. Optimize System Visual Effects and Notifications
Reduce unnecessary visual overhead and distractions within Windows that can consume resources and break immersion.
-
Adjust Visual Effects for Best Performance Medium impact
Search for 'Adjust the appearance and performance of Windows'. In the 'Visual Effects' tab, select 'Adjust for best performance' or customize to disable animations and shadows.
-
Disable Notifications and Focus Assist Low impact
Go to Settings > System > Notifications & actions and turn off notifications. Enable 'Focus Assist' and set it to 'Alarms only' or 'When I'm playing a game'.
-
Turn Off Transparency Effects Low impact
Go to Settings > Personalization > Colors and toggle 'Transparency effects' to Off. This saves a small amount of GPU resources.
6.6. Disk Cleanup and Optimization
Maintain a healthy storage drive to ensure fast asset loading and prevent stutters caused by slow data access.
-
Perform Disk Cleanup Medium impact
Search for 'Disk Cleanup' in Windows. Select your C: drive and check options like 'Temporary files', 'Recycle Bin', and 'Delivery Optimization Files' to free up space.
-
Optimize Drives (TRIM for SSDs) Medium impact
Search for 'Defragment and Optimize Drives'. Select your SSD (if applicable) and click 'Optimize'. For HDDs, defragmentation can help, but Valorant benefits more from SSDs.
-
Monitor Disk Health Low impact
Use tools like CrystalDiskInfo to monitor the health of your SSD/HDD. A failing drive can severely impact game performance.
Recommended Valorant settings
| Setting | Recommended value | Why it matters |
|---|---|---|
| Material Quality | Low | Reduces the complexity of surfaces, significantly impacting GPU load without a major visual disadvantage for competitive play. |
| Texture Quality | Low | Lowering this reduces VRAM usage and GPU processing. The GTX 1660 has 6GB VRAM, but for maximum FPS, low is ideal. |
| Detail Quality | Low | Minimizes the detail of environmental objects, which can help reduce visual clutter and improve target acquisition. |
| Anti-Aliasing | None | Removes jagged edges but comes at a significant performance cost. For competitive play, prioritize FPS and clarity over smoothness. |
| Multithreaded Rendering | On | Crucial for modern CPUs, allowing Valorant to utilize multiple CPU cores efficiently, leading to higher and more stable frame rates. |
| V-Sync | Off | Eliminates input lag by allowing the GPU to render frames as fast as possible, independent of your monitor's refresh rate. |
| Resolution | Native (e.g., 1920x1080) | Playing at your monitor's native resolution ensures the sharpest image, which is vital for spotting enemies and crosshair placement. |
| Limit FPS - Always | Off | Allow your GTX 1660 to render frames uncapped to achieve the lowest possible input latency, especially with a high refresh rate monitor. |

Frequently asked questions
Does Windows Game Mode actually help Valorant performance?
Yes, Windows Game Mode can help by prioritizing Valorant's resources and suppressing background activities. While the impact might vary, it's generally recommended to keep it enabled for competitive gaming.
How does Riot Vanguard (anti-cheat) affect my PC's performance?
Riot Vanguard runs at a kernel level, which can introduce a slight overhead. While Riot strives to minimize its impact, it's a necessary component for Valorant's integrity. Ensuring your Windows is optimized helps mitigate any potential performance hit.
Is a GTX 1660 sufficient for competitive Valorant?
Absolutely. A GTX 1660 is more than capable of delivering high and consistent frame rates (well over 144 FPS) in Valorant at 1080p, especially with the recommended settings and Windows optimizations, making it excellent for competitive play.
Should I disable full-screen optimizations for Valorant?
For some users, disabling full-screen optimizations can reduce input lag and improve frame pacing. It's worth testing if you experience any micro-stutters or feel a slight delay in your actions. You can find this option in the game's executable properties.
What's the best way to monitor my FPS and system performance in Valorant?
Valorant has a built-in FPS counter (Settings > Video > Stats). For more detailed system monitoring (CPU/GPU usage, temperatures), tools like MSI Afterburner (with RivaTuner Statistics Server) or NVIDIA's GeForce Experience overlay are excellent choices.
